Wonderful trail for walking, running and biking throughout the year! The scenery is beautiful and it is always well kept. I always have a good time taking my dog, Stella, there for walks and there is a creek that runs along it for her to play in!
I love love love this trail. It’s short but traverses some less traveled roads so if you need to get in more miles than the 5 (2.5 each way) you could pretty easily add some roads without too much worries of cars. This is all in the middle of farmland and the trail is super shaded.
Nice flat wide elevated walk between many large active farms. Canopy of trees overhead. Creek on one side of the trail. Bathrooms at the trailhead, parking.
It's a peaceful, shaded, and easy walk through the middle of farmland and partially alongside a creek. Don't expect to hike here, but it's a nice walking trail. The only downside is that it'd be great if it was longer than 2.25 miles!
